Even during the lawsuit MGA was allowed to continue to sell Bratz and were never actually recalled. Their shelf presence wasn't nearly as great as at their peak, but they were still being sold. Lawsuit aside, the market and tastes have changed a lot since 2001 when Bratz debuted. There is also a lot more competition in the Pink Isle with Liv, Tinker Bell, Monster High, My Scene, Twilight, Disney Princesses, etc.
I personally think Bratz will end up being a niche market. I don't think the dolls will be able to reinvent themselves enough to recapture their glory days. Also the 88 million dollar lawsuit is only the settlement for Mattel making claims that they were stealing the idea. MGA is planning a lost income based on Mattel "damaging" the Bratz name. It's a pretty sound guess that MGA will not sell near the amount of dolls they did prior to 4 years ago when the suit was opened. The economy alone would support that. MGA wants damages if they can't restore the sales numbers they had and that could mean Mattel possibly ends up eating their losses based on the sagging economy. Kind of a kick in the nads when you consider it looked like they were trying to do the same thing to MGA in the initial suit. They're saying the total case could top 250 million that MGA gets.
